Stephan Amm a really "lucky shot"! I went into the forest at sunset to get some fog with sun mood when I suddenly heard some tits shouted very loud. I looked upon the trees and saw the small pygmy owl surrounded by the grumbling birds. During the whole dawn I stayed there and got different shots, the one below I like most...

Stephan Amm For a long time I tried to get some Pulsatilla vulgaris with some ice crystals on them. Yesterday I started at 5 a.m. and went to my favorite location in "franconian switzerland" to be there to get the right moment. After a long time (-5°C) laying in the meadow the sun started to cross the edge of the hill behind the flowers. This was my time...
